Average Bathroom Renovation Costs in North York

In North York, bathroom renovation costs can vary widely depending on the scope of the project and the materials used. On average, a mid-range bathroom renovation can cost between $10,000 and $20,000. This typically includes new fixtures, flooring, and wall tiles, as well as minor layout changes. For a more upscale renovation with high-end materials and custom features, costs can range from $20,000 to $40,000 or more.

A basic bathroom update, which may involve repainting, new lighting fixtures, and replacing the vanity, can cost as little as $5,000 to $10,000. This type of renovation is ideal for those looking to refresh their bathroom without breaking the bank. It’s a great option for homeowners who want to improve the look and feel of their space while staying within a limited budget.

At the higher end of the spectrum, luxury bathroom renovations can exceed $50,000. These projects often feature top-of-the-line materials, custom cabinetry, high-tech fixtures, and intricate design details. Homeowners who opt for luxury renovations are typically looking for a spa-like experience in their own home. While these renovations come with a hefty price tag, they can add significant value to your property.

Budgeting for Your Bathroom Renovation

Creating a realistic budget is a crucial step in the bathroom renovation process. Start by determining how much you are willing to spend on the project. Consider your financial situation and set a budget that aligns with your goals and priorities. It’s important to be realistic about what you can afford and to leave some wiggle room for unexpected expenses.

Once you have a budget in mind, break it down into specific categories such as materials, labor, permits, and contingency. This will help you allocate funds appropriately and ensure that all aspects of the renovation are covered. Be sure to get detailed quotes from contractors and suppliers to get an accurate estimate of the costs involved.

A common pitfall in bathroom renovations is underestimating the cost of labor and additional expenses. To avoid this, add a contingency fund of at least 10-15% of the total budget. This extra cushion can help cover any unforeseen issues that may arise during the renovation process, such as hidden water damage or structural problems. By planning for the unexpected, you can ensure that your renovation stays on track and within budget.

Cost Breakdown: Materials vs. Labor

Understanding the cost breakdown of your bathroom renovation can help you make informed decisions and prioritize your spending. Generally, the total cost of a bathroom renovation is divided between materials and labor. On average, materials account for about 50-60% of the total cost, while labor makes up the remaining 40-50%.

Materials include everything from tiles, fixtures, and cabinetry to paint, lighting, and accessories. The cost of materials can vary widely depending on the quality and brand you choose. For example, high-end materials such as marble tiles and custom vanities will be more expensive than standard ceramic tiles and pre-fabricated vanities. It’s important to choose materials that fit your budget and meet your design preferences.

Labor costs encompass the work of skilled tradespeople such as plumbers, electricians, carpenters, and tile setters. The complexity of the work and the level of expertise required can impact labor costs. Additionally, labor costs can vary based on the region and the contractor’s experience. In North York, it’s essential to hire reputable contractors who are familiar with local building codes and regulations. While labor costs can be significant, hiring experienced professionals can ensure a high-quality and timely renovation.

Financing Options for Your Bathroom Renovation

Financing your bathroom renovation can be a challenge, especially if you’re working with a limited budget. Fortunately, there are several financing options available to help you fund your project. One common option is a home equity loan or line of credit. These loans allow you to borrow against the equity in your home and typically offer lower interest rates than other types of loans. However, they require good credit and can put your home at risk if you’re unable to repay the loan.

Another financing option is a personal loan. Personal loans are unsecured loans that can be used for a variety of purposes, including home renovations. They typically have higher interest rates than home equity loans but don’t require collateral. Personal loans can be a good option if you have good credit and need quick access to funds.

Credit cards can also be used to finance bathroom renovations, but they should be used with caution. Credit cards offer convenience and flexibility, but they often come with high-interest rates that can lead to significant debt if not managed properly. If you choose to use a credit card, look for one with a low-interest rate or a promotional offer such as a 0% APR for a limited time. Be sure to pay off the balance as quickly as possible to avoid accruing interest.
